Provo College
Provo, Utah. 12 certificate and associate programs, private, for-profit. 12 of them report what graduates earn; for the rest, the figure below is what the occupation pays in Utah.
| Program | Credential | Median debt | Graduates earn | The occupation pays |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Allied Health and Medical Assisting Services | Undergraduate certificate | $11,052 | $23,456 (13) | $45,360 Medical Assistants |

"Graduates earn" is the median two years after completing, from the U.S. Department of Education's College Scorecard, released 2026-06-10; the number in brackets is how many graduates it covers. A dash means the Department has not published a figure — it withholds any median computed from too few graduates — and never that the figure is zero. "The occupation pays" is the state median for the occupation the program leads to, from the BLS Occupational Employment and Wage Statistics survey, and describes everyone in that job rather than graduates of this school.
